At its 'Training Awards' ceremony held last week, PricewaterhouseCoopers (PwC) brought together 200 of the company's internal trainers to thank them for their contribution.

Nicolas Lefèvre, partner responsible for PwC's Academy, thanked the employees who used their expertise in client training throughout the year.

"The success of PwC's Academy is intrinsically linked to the commitment of our experts who are passionate about training and who share their enthusiasm in courses oriented to the acquisition of skills in the field," explained Nicolas Lefèvre. "Our trainers trainers have succceeded in exceeding the limits of their function as experts in popularising their specialisations among varied publics."

The PwC Academy aims to offer both technical and behavioural training, with 200 courses provided in 2015 through 186 PwC Luxembourg employees. Topics covered range from the financial and non-financial sector to social networks in business.

"Our internal trainers have been able to use the experience in their area of expertise in courses dedicated to clients," continued Nicolas Lefèvre. "They added an educational approach to their recognised technical expertise in order to explain occasionally complex subjects, whilst remaining attentive to the needs of their audience."

All participants were presented with an award for their commitment following the ceremony.
